Hi Priya,

Welcome to the Fernvale on-call rotation. The greenhouse controller's humidity sensors drift upward after about three weeks of runtime; the alert fires when drift exceeds 4%. It's almost never a real failure — recalibrate remotely first, replace only if drift returns within 48 hours. The full recalibration procedure is documented on the page below.

dashboard of yafog-fajof = https://jira.tolvaqsys.internal/pages/pages/projects/49fe21c4

Subject: Handover — consent banner rollout

Taking PTO Thursday. Consent banner for Quellhaven ships tonight. Banner state writes to `consent_events`; volume will spike, so watch replication lag on the Torvale replica. If lag exceeds 30s, pause the rollout via the flag service — don't touch the schema. Migration already applied to all three shards. Rollback script is in the handover folder. The events database is reachable at the connection string below.

replica DSN, kajep-yahag: mssql://praok_svc:iF@db-8d68.plorvaio.local:5432/eliion

TURN-208: Gatevale turnstile counters at the Merrow Field pilot double-count when a rotation reverses mid-cycle. Attendance totals drift roughly 2% high per event. The debounce window fix is implemented, reviewed by Ilsa, and soak-tested across two simulated match days without drift. Ready for your cut; the candidate build is identified below.

trace token, tagag-tafog: htk6_5ed18c